Medical Physicist in Radiotherapy. I obtained my Bachelors degree in Physics from the Faculty of Sciences of USJ in 2007. I then continued my studies in medical physics at the University of Paris-Sud obtained a Master's degree in Medical Radiophysics in 2009. I then obtained a PhD from the University of Paris-Sud. My thesis work focused on Monte Carlo simulations of doses due to secondary neutrons in proton therapy. In 2013, I obtained the Qualification Diploma in Radiological and Medical Physics. I then worked in radiotherapy departments (North East Parisian Oncology and Radiotherapy Center, Hôtel Dieu de France in Beirut, Sainte-Clotilde Clinic in Reunion Island). I currently work as a medical radiophysicist in the radiotherapy department of the Hôtel Dieu de France in Beirut.
